Photo of a contemporary front yard retaining wall landscape in Denver.Type of blocks: Cinder blocks are hollow, typically measuring 8-in. by 8-in. by 16-in., costing $2.50 to $3 per block. Comparable concrete blocks are a little less expensive, $2 to $2.50 each. You can also go with split-faced blocks to add character, running $2.50 to $3.50 each. The block is uniform in shape, color and ...Clean the Cinder Blocks. There are a few ways you can clean your cinder blocks. You can use a masonry cleaner, or you can also mix 1/2 cup of trisodium phosphate with 2 gallons of water. When using chemical products, use eye goggles, a mask, and gloves. Apply the cleaner to the cinder blocks, and scrub them with a nylon brush.Backstory: in the process of buying a house with a cinder block fence, similar to above (don't know what to call them, but they're made of cinder block type material but have cut outs), but it is quite short, only about 3 or so feet tall. Next apply Loctite …Purchase a tube of caulk at the hardware or home improvement store and locate any cracks in the cinder block. Cut about 0.25 inches (0.64 cm) off the tip of the caulk and push the caulk to the tip of the tube with your hands or a caulking gun. Then, apply the caulk to the crack liberally, covering the joint completely.Fences are needed for many reasons, serve a host of uses and come in many different sizes and designs. Buried eight feet into the solid rock, the master bedroom is the coolest room in the ... Cinder block walls for houses cost $25 per square foot, including labor. If you want to line your garage with cinder block walls, you will pay $23 per square foot for those additions. Fences made from cinder blocks cost $22 per square foot while retaining walls are priced at $28.
